Reliance Jio, the country's largest telecom firm, said on Saturday that it will expand 5G telephony services offering ultra-high-speed internet connectivity to every part of the country by December 2023.
Jio entered the telecom sector in September 2016, offering free voice calls and dirt-cheap data, forcing the competition to either match or fold up/consolidate.
Mr. Ambani has now promised cost-effective 5G services.
"Today, I want to reaffirm Jio's commitment to delivering 5G to every town, taluka, and tehsil in our country by December 2023," he said at the India Mobile Congress (IMC) conference in New Delhi.
Mr. Ambani announced the rollout of 5G services from four metro cities of Delhi, Mumbai, Chennai, and Kolkata by Diwali at his flagship Reliance Industries Ltd's annual shareholder meeting in August.
He added that 5G and 5G-enabled digital solutions can bring affordable and high-quality education and skill development within the reach of common Indians because the majority of Jio's 5G is developed in India.
It can provide high-quality healthcare to rural and remote areas by converting existing hospitals into smart hospitals with little additional investment, making the best doctors' services digitally available anywhere in India, improving diagnostic speed and accuracy, and enabling real-time clinical decision making.
According to him, 5G can also bridge the urban-rural divide by accelerating digitisation and intelligent data management in agriculture, services, trade, industry, the informal sector, transportation, and energy infrastructure.
"By incorporating AI into every domain, 5G can help India become the world's intelligence capital. This will assist India in becoming a significant exporter of high-value digital solutions and services "he said, adding that all of this will spark a massive surge in entrepreneurship in the country.This, in turn, will attract even larger investments and result in the creation of millions of new jobs.
Mr. Ambani stated that by combining the power of demography and digital technologies, India can become the world's leading digital society, accelerating growth by making India a $40 trillion economy by 2047, up from $3 trillion now, and rapidly increasing per capita income to more than $20,000, up from $2,000.
"It's not an exaggeration to say that 5G is like a Digital Kamadhenu, the heavenly cow that grants us whatever we want," he said.
With 5G, India will be able to take longer and faster steps toward "Sab Ka Digital Saath and Sab Ka Digital Vikas," he said. "India may have started late, but we'll finish first by deploying 5G services."Mr. Ambani stated that 5G is much more than just the next generation of connectivity technology, offering foundational technology that unlocks the full potential of other transformative technologies such as artificial intelligence, internet of things, robotics, blockchain, and the metaverse.
